NFPA
1975(04) Protect fire and emergency services personnel with thermally stable textiles. NFPA 1975 specifies minimum requirements for the design, performance, testing, and certification of station/work uniforms that are non-primary protective garments, so that they will not cause or contribute to burn injury severity.
